A DECOMPOSITION ALGORITHM FOR QUADRATIC PROGRAMMING,

Abstract

This paper presented one possible approach to solving a convex quadratic programming problem where the number of constraints is large, but of a special structure. In a problem with a large number of constraints a direct approach may be impossible since the size of the initial basis matrix would cause difficulty in determining its inverse. While in the present algorithm the dimensionality may increase one may always obtain, at worst, approximate solutions. (Author)
